[OLD] Q. What is Outlook Web Access (OWA)?
A. Outlook Web Access (OWA) is a web-based service that allows you to access your ACES Exchange mailbox from any computer with an internet connection, by simply launching an internet browser and going to exchange.aces.uiuc.edu. This is an easy way to check your email/calendar information while out of the office, using only your NetID and ACES Active Directory (AD) password. While it works on most browsers, Internet Explorer 6.0 (or newer) offers the most features.
